US US retail sales rose 0.6% to kick off the third quarter, topping expectations for a 0.3% gain. The strength in retail sales was broad based, with motor vehicle and parts dealers’ sales increasing 1.2% and building material and garden equipment and supplies dealers’ sales increasing 1.2% after registering a 1.1% gain in June. US CPI consensus had estimated prices increased at a 0.2% pace in July, for both the headline and core CPI. The print came in softer than forecasted for the fourth consecutive month, as both headline and core rose 0.1% in July. Both are up 1.7% year-on-year.
